TEV-1 is a double thermostat designated for system of protection of roof watershoots  
against freezing. The device is placed in a waterproof box (IP65), sensor with double  
insulation, which is a part of the device, senses ambientrature. The device operates  
as zonal thermostata with independent setting of upper and bottom operational  
temperature. In case the ambient temperature is higher than T1 (upper temperature),  
thermostat switches heating of watershoots off (icing melts down). In case the ambient  
temperature is lower than T2 (bottom temperature),thermostat also switches heating off  
(to big freezing heating cannot manage to melt the ice).

Warning  
The device is constructed to be connected into 1-phase main and must be installed in  
accordance with regulations and norms applicable in a particular country. Installation,  
connection and setting can be done only by a person with an adequate electro-technical  
qualification which has read and understood this instruction manual and product  
functions. The device contains protections against over-voltage peaks and disturbing  
elements in the supply main. Too ensure correct function of these protection elements  
it is necessary to front-end other protective elements of higher degree (A, B, C) and  
screening of disturbances of switched devices (contactors, motors, inductive load etc.) as  
it is stated in a standard. Before you start with installation, make sure that the device is  
not energized and that the main switch is OFF. Do not install the device to the sources of  
excessive electromagnetic disturbances. By correct installation, ensure good air circulation  
so the maximal allowed operational temperature is not exceeded in case of permanent  
operation and higher ambient temperature. While installing the device use screwdriver  
width approx. 2 mm. Keep in mind that this device is fully electronic while installing.  
Correct function of the device is also depended on transportation, storing and handling.  
In case you notice any signs of damage, deformation, malfunction or missing piece, do  
not install this device and claim it at the seller. After operational life treat the product as  
electronic waste.
